I've been following the development of a new #DesktopEnvironment, and I gotta say…
Why is it.that as soon as someone makes something that's different, people swoop in and say "You have to add this feature so it works like #Gnome / #Plasma /Whateverthefuck"?
Like… let's take the Minimize button. Useful in Windows, but far from the only way to deal with setting stuff aside. #Niri handles it with Workspaces and Columns. Gnome (by default) handles it with Overview and Workspaces plus limited snapping. I like that about Gnome and Niri (with #Noctalia or #Dank added in, Niri's my favorite).
DEs work without minimize buttons. If someone's designing a #DE without it, and you need it, maybe you're not the target audience. Maybe it's designed for Owlbears.
And that's just one example. I dunno. It's obviously not a big deal and everyone's entitled to their opinion. It's just weird to me to insist that a DE needs something it was obviously designed to work without.

KaOS 2026.06 RC: التوزيعة المستقلة تتخلى عن systemd وتتبنى Dinit و Niri
أصدرت KaOS الإصدار التجريبي 2026.06 RC، الذي يمثل خطوة جذرية في مسار التوزيعة. تتخلى عن systemd كمدير تهيئة وخدمات، وتستبدله بـ Dinit، مع استبدال KDE Plasma بـ Niri/Noctalia في صورة النظام، واعتماد greetd و Limine، مع...
🔗 https://salehgnutux.github.io/GT-NEWSTECH/ar/gnulinux/kaos-dinit-2026-rc/

@darkpixel #Quickshell is not a shell. It's the toolkit to build the shell with. (Actually, both #DMS and #Noctalia are built from it.)
But nitpicking aside, Quickshell is my late love on Linux. It is all I'd hope GUI building would be twenty years ago when I'd despair writing GTK 2.
